The Turkmenistan Pyrogen Testing Market is a niche segment within the country`s healthcare industry that focuses on the detection and measurement of pyrogens in pharmaceutical products and medical devices to ensure they are free from fever-causing contaminants. The market is driven by the increasing emphasis on product safety and quality standards in Turkmenistan`s healthcare sector, particularly in pharmaceutical manufacturing. Key players in the Turkmenistan Pyrogen Testing Market offer a range of pyrogen testing services and products, including bacterial endotoxin testing and recombinant factor C assays. The market is expected to see steady growth as regulatory requirements for pyrogen testing become more stringent, leading to greater demand for reliable testing methods and technologies to ensure the safety and efficacy of healthcare products in Turkmenistan.

The Turkmenistan government has implemented stringent regulations related to pyrogen testing in the pharmaceutical industry to ensure product safety and quality. The State Sanitary and Epidemiological Service enforces these regulations, requiring all pharmaceutical companies to conduct pyrogen testing on their products before they can be approved for sale in the market. Additionally, the government has set specific guidelines and standards for pyrogen testing procedures to be followed by manufacturers, with penalties for non-compliance. These policies aim to protect public health by ensuring that pharmaceutical products are free from harmful pyrogens, ultimately contributing to a safer and more reliable healthcare system in Turkmenistan.
